From 6fe64aba047386da32a6ac0fa4029fbb83ee496a Mon Sep 17 00:00:00 2001 From: rnburn Date: Tue, 24 Oct 2017 13:37:45 -0700 Subject: [PATCH] Set --modules-path. --- images/nginx-slim/build.sh | 6 +----- rootfs/etc/nginx/template/nginx.tmpl | 4 ++-- 2 files changed, 3 insertions(+), 7 deletions(-) diff --git a/images/nginx-slim/build.sh b/images/nginx-slim/build.sh index 946f8b5a1..30da46ef7 100755 --- a/images/nginx-slim/build.sh +++ b/images/nginx-slim/build.sh @@ -217,6 +217,7 @@ fi ./configure \ --prefix=/usr/share/nginx \ --conf-path=/etc/nginx/nginx.conf \ + --modules-path=/etc/nginx/modules \ --http-log-path=/var/log/nginx/access.log \ --error-log-path=/var/log/nginx/error.log \ --lock-path=/var/lock/nginx.lock \ @@ -238,11 +239,6 @@ fi && make || exit 1 \ && make install || exit 1 -if [[ ${ARCH} == "x86_64" ]]; then - mkdir -p /etc/nginx/modules/ - cp objs/ngx_http_modsecurity_module.so /etc/nginx/modules/ -fi - echo "Cleaning..." cd / diff --git a/rootfs/etc/nginx/template/nginx.tmpl b/rootfs/etc/nginx/template/nginx.tmpl index a3a9cbbee..8219e0e5e 100644 --- a/rootfs/etc/nginx/template/nginx.tmpl +++ b/rootfs/etc/nginx/template/nginx.tmpl @@ -12,11 +12,11 @@ load_module /etc/nginx/modules/ngx_http_modsecurity_module.so; {{ end }} {{ if $cfg.EnableOpentracing }} -load_module modules/ngx_http_opentracing_module.so; +load_module /etc/nginx/modules/ngx_http_opentracing_module.so; {{ end }} {{ if (and $cfg.EnableOpentracing (ne $cfg.ZipkinCollectorHost "")) }} -load_module modules/ngx_http_zipkin_module.so; +load_module /etc/nginx/modules/ngx_http_zipkin_module.so; {{ end }} daemon off;